A Texas Man Is Searching for the Woman Who Paid for His Meal — Four Years After She Did It

In 2021, a woman walked into an Applebee's in Paris, Texas, noticed a man eating alone, and made a quiet decision. She paid for his meal. She left a handwritten note. Then she walked out, never knowing what she'd set in motion.

Four years later, that man is still carrying the note. And now he's asking the internet to help him find her.

What the Note Said

The woman's message was simple and specific. She told the man she had noticed he was eating alone and wanted him to know that kindness still exists. But the note revealed something much deeper than that.

She shared that she had lost her husband seven years earlier. The day she wrote the note — the day she bought a stranger his dinner — was the first time she had eaten alone in public since her husband's death. She was doing something hard, and she chose to mark the occasion by doing something kind.

"I hope it might make you smile knowing that kindness still exists," she wrote. "I still pray and I pray that God brings you peace."

He kept the note.

What Changed

For four years the note stayed with him — something he held onto without fully understanding why. Then in 2025, his wife passed away.

In the grief that followed, he picked up the note again. This time he understood it differently. The woman hadn't just been kind to a stranger over dinner. She had been writing from inside her own loss, reaching out across a table to someone she didn't know, because she recognized something in the moment that called for it.

He sat down and wrote her a response — a handwritten letter of his own.

"You touched my heart that day," he wrote. "Loss is something no words can explain, and no feeling can contain."

He explained that her kindness had stayed with him through the years, and that now, having lost his own wife, he finally understood the weight behind her words in a way he couldn't before. He said he wanted to find her. Not just to say thank you, but to honor his late wife by repaying what was once given to him.

"I would like to repay the kindness that you once showed me in honor of my late wife," he wrote. "I would like to set things right."

The Search

The staff at Paris Coffee, a local coffee shop in Paris, Texas, shared both letters on Facebook and asked the community for help tracking down the mystery woman. They called her "an angel among us" and said they were hoping to help one of their "amazing customers" find her.

"We know it's been a while," the shop wrote, "but we also know how powerful this community is."

The post spread quickly. As of this writing, the woman has not yet been publicly identified. The search continues.

Why This One Stays With You

There's something particular about this story that makes it land differently than most random acts of kindness. It isn't just that a woman paid for a stranger's meal. It's that she did it on the hardest kind of day — her first time eating alone after years of grief — and chose to spend that moment on someone else.

And it isn't just that he kept the note for four years. It's that he understood it more fully only after walking into the same loss himself.

Two people, separated by years and circumstance, connected by grief and a handwritten note left at an Applebee's in a small Texas town. One meal. One note. And apparently, that's enough to last a very long time.
